Are you being pushed away or pulled in?

Galatians 4: 19 NKJV “Until Christ is formed in you.” Being born again is one thing and renewing your mind is another thing, it is a process that is taking time.  Once the concept of becoming a newborn Christian has taken place there will be a process that is going to take place in changing you to becoming more and more like the Lord Jesus. The only way you are able to become more and more like the Lord Jesus is during your intimate time you spend with the Lord.  You are building a relationship with God and the only way to do that is through studying God’s Word – The Bible and your quiet time with the Lord.  This needs to be done on a daily basis. As young Christians, you start forming an alliance with the Lord.  You become more and more like the Lord and you are able to recall many scriptures.  Now God is changing you from the inside and you are being Holy. Are you Happy?

Psalm 37: 4-5 AMP “Delight yourself in the LORD, and He will give you the desires and petitions of your heart.  Commit your way to the LORD; trust in Him also and He will do it.” Today as you start your day I want to encourage you to take the first couple of minutes of your day and think of all the good things that you have received during this week.  Sit down and make a list.  Looking for each gift or surprise that came your way.  Now think of the person who gave it to you, and then say thank you. Now think of all the wonderful gifts God has given you during this week.  Write it down and think of the people that do not have half the gifts you have right now in your life.  Then go and take delight in the LORD. By making a mental note you cannot actually perceive the amount of great and wonderful things that you have received from the LORD.  It will disappear like mist in the sunlight.
